Usage
Information
Enter a supplicants MAC address using the mac-address option to display CoS mapping information
only for the specified supplicant.
You can display the CoS mapping information applied to traffic from authenticated supplicants on 802.1X-
enabled ports that are in Single-Hot, Multi-Host, and Multi-Supplicant authentication modes.

show dot1x interface
Display the 802.1X configuration of an interface.
C9000 Series
Syntax
show dot1x interface interface [mac-address mac-address]
Parameters
interface
Enter one of the following keywords and slot/port or number information:
For a 10-Gigabit Ethernet interface, enter the keyword
TenGigabitEthernet then the slot/port information.
For a 40-Gigabit Ethernet interface, enter the keyword fortyGigE then the
slot/port information.
mac-address
(Optional) MAC address of a supplicant.
